Description of the goods or services required
The third sector in Wales play a crucial role in providing care and support services. As Local Authorities (LA) resources and capacity are reduced people are encour-aged to look at other means of receiving care and support services. As a result, an increased amount of community / third sector-based care and support services are delivered to fill the gap.
With an increase focus on prevention and early intervention as part of the social services and wellbeing act. Third sector organisations are playing a crucial role in delivering these services. However we do not currently have a full understanding of the role and impact of these services.
We want to appoint a contractor to work with us and key third sector organisations in Wales such as Wales Council for Voluntary Action (WCVA) and other local volun-tary services to deliver an impact assessment study to help us understand the fol-lowing:
1. Number of third sector organisations delivering carer and support services
2. Number of people third sector organisation are supporting in Wales.
3. Impact of third sector services in preventing critical care and support needs
4. Highlight good practice – where good work is happening in giving people voice and control
We are currently working on a project Supporting the Development of Community resilience Opportunities, focusing on; building community resilience to support community based organisations in providing social care, the successful contractor would be expected to forge strong links with the networks established as part of this work and compliment the outputs of this project.
The supplier will be expected to deliver the following:
- Collated data and information presented in a visual format to enable the shar-ing of evidence with partners. The output should be able to be integrated into our Social care Data Portal
- Engage with key stakeholders and capture the intelligence from engagement activities
- Set out recommendations for a sustainable approach to establishing the role and contribution of the third sector in providing care and support services in Wales.
- Provide a final report setting out the key findings
